Three steps: (1) Buy your South-Latin-America plan on Bitcall and receive a QR code instantly via email. (2) Scan the QR code in your phone's settings while connected to WiFi — you can do this at home before your trip. (3) When you arrive in South-Latin-America, turn off airplane mode. Your eSIM connects to null automatically. The data validity period only starts counting from the moment you first connect in South-Latin-America, not from when you buy it.
Yes. The Bitcall eSIM runs alongside your existing SIM using your phone's dual-SIM capability. Your home number stays active for incoming calls, SMS, and two-factor authentication codes. The eSIM handles your mobile data in South-Latin-America through null. You do not need to remove your physical SIM — both work at the same time.

If your phone was released after 2018 and supports eSIM, it will work in South-Latin-America. This includes iPhone XS and all later models, Samsung Galaxy S20 and later, Google Pixel 3 and later, and most recent devices from Huawei, Xiaomi, Motorola, and OnePlus. Your phone must also be carrier-unlocked. The South-Latin-America networks (null) use standard frequencies that work with any unlocked eSIM-compatible phone sold globally.
